Chapter 7: Improving Body Composition ØBody composition is the ratio between fat mass and fat-free mass ØFat-free mass includes all tissues exclusive of fat (muscle, bone, organs, fluids) ØEssential fat is necessary for normal biological function ØEssential fat for men is 3% to 5% of total weight; it is 8% to 12% percent for women

Obesity and Overweight ØObesity is overfatness ØObesity in men is defined as body fat equal to or greater than 25% of total body weight ØObesity in women is defined as body fat equal to or greater than 32% of total body weight ØOverweight is excessive weight for height and does not consider body composition

Regional Fat Distribution ØMost women store fat in the hips, buttocks, thighs, and breasts (gynoid fat) ØMost men store fat in the abdomen, lower back, chest, and nape of the neck (android fat)  Intra-abdominal fat is stored deep in the abdominal cavity and carries a high risk for certain diseases

Methods of Measurement ØHeight-weight tables do not measure body composition ØBody Mass Index (BMI) is weight (kg) divided by height squared (m) ØThe waist-to-hip ratio (WHR) is a simple method for determining body fat distribution ØWaist circumference can also predict disease risk

Regional Fat Distribution (3) ØEnzymes in abdominal fat cells allow these fat cells to be routed directly to the liver for the production of cholesterol ØAbdominal cells are larger than other fat cells; large fat cells are associated with blood glucose intolerance and excessive blood insulin (associated with diabetes)  Excessive blood insulin may promote hypertension

Methods of Measuring Body-Weight Status ØHeight/weight tables do not reflect body composition and are poor instruments for weight-loss recommendations ØBody mass index (BMI) is the ratio of body weight in kilograms to height in meters squared  People with BMIs of 25 to 29.9 are considered overweight; people with BMIs of 30 or higher are considered obese

Measuring Body Composition ØThe only direct way to measure the fat content of humans is through chemical analysis of cadavers ØUnderwater weighing is one of the most accurate indirect measurement techniques  People with more muscle mass weigh more in water than those with less

Measuring Body Composition (2) ØBioelectrical impedance analysis uses a low-level, single-frequency electric current to measure body composition ØSkinfold measurements are one of the most economical ways to measure body composition and, when performed by skilled technicians, correlate well with hydrostatic weighing ØAir-Displacement Plethysmography uses air displacement rather than water displacement for assessing body composition by sitting in the Bod Pod
